竞争在美国的工程专职教师职位
Siddhartha Roy1,2, Brenda Velasco2, Marc A Edwards2
1Department of Environmental Sciences, Rutgers University, New Brunswick, NJ 08901, USA.
PNAS nexus
|May 8, 2024
概括
工程博士毕业生不太可能获得专职教师职位,平均成功率为12.4%. 该研究建议在博士培训期间强调替代职业道路.

背景情况:
- 工程博士学位的学术就业市场竞争激烈.
- 了解博士毕业生的长期职业前景至关重要.
- 对于职业规划而言,关于任期教师职位的数据是必不可少的.
研究的目的:
- 确定工程博士毕业生在美国获得任职教师职位的可能性.
- 分析2006年至2021年工程博士学位学术就业趋势.
- 为博士培训计划提供关于现实的职业成果的信息.
主要方法:
- 对工程博士毕业生和教师的综合年度数据的分析.
- 数据来源于美国工程教育学会 (ASEE) 的2006-2021年数据.
- 统计分析以确定趋势和计算就业可能性.
主要成果:
- 在2006年至2021年期间,工程博士毕业生获得专职职位的平均概率为12.4%.
- 从2006年到2014年,这种可能性出现了显著的下降,随后出现了稳定.
- 大约每8名工程博士毕业生中就有1名获得了终身职位.
结论:
- 大多数工程博士毕业生不会获得专职教师职位.
- 博士培训应包括对各种职业发展轨迹的讨论.
- 将学生的期望与职业现实相协调,对于成功过渡至关重要.
